https://git.reactos.org/?p=reactos.git;a=commitdiff;h=bcba9306227ade497e98b5...
commit bcba9306227ade497e98b50ff65feac0ae3dca3b Author: Katayama Hirofumi MZ katayama.hirofumi.mz@gmail.com AuthorDate: Thu Mar 11 16:55:49 2021 +0900 Commit: Katayama Hirofumi MZ katayama.hirofumi.mz@gmail.com CommitDate: Thu Mar 11 16:56:01 2021 +0900
[BROWSEUI] Fix CAutoComplete::OnMeasureItem assertion
CORE-17505 --- dll/win32/browseui/CAutoComplete.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/dll/win32/browseui/CAutoComplete.cpp b/dll/win32/browseui/CAutoComplete.cpp index 9bb6405d594..b5dfa888abd 100644 --- a/dll/win32/browseui/CAutoComplete.cpp +++ b/dll/win32/browseui/CAutoComplete.cpp @@ -1781,7 +1781,8 @@ LRESULT CAutoComplete::OnMeasureItem(UINT uMsg, WPARAM wParam, LPARAM lParam, BO ATLASSERT(pMeasure != NULL); if (pMeasure->CtlType != ODT_LISTVIEW) return FALSE; - + if (!m_hwndList) + return FALSE; ATLASSERT(m_hwndList.GetStyle() & LVS_OWNERDRAWFIXED); pMeasure->itemHeight = m_hwndList.m_cyItem; // height of item return TRUE;